It Was Love at First Bite
Alexa brought a fun cookbook home from school that was all about cake pops/balls. Some of the designs are so clever in the way they use different sprinkles to make cat's ears, bunny tails, etc. I guess it's kind of like scrapbooking, just on cake, right? LOL! Anyway, I told her we could try making basic cake balls, meaning she could pick a cake flavor, a coating flavor, and some sprinkles. Since Friday was a day off from school (Superintendent's Day), she invited her friend, Taylor, over. While the girls played, I baked a 13 x 9" chocolate cake, let it cool, and then crumbled it (I'm not sure I'm sold on the merits of crumbling up a perfectly good cake yet, LOL!). After that I called the girls down and they used a portion scoop to make the cake balls and then dipped them in chocolate coating and decorated them with Valentine sprinkles. Let's just say they were chomping at the bit to try one as soon as they finished and it was definitely love at first bite. :)

This was a tough one to get on paper. In fact, I've been putting it off for almost a year now. It's about the birthday card I made for my Dad last year, but never got to give him. :(Dad, I made this card for your 70th birthday except I never got to give it to you. The girls and I even created a beautiful photo book for you. This was a birthday the whole family was supposed to celebrate with you in Florida, something you had looked forward to, and planned, for months. We were going to cruise the Intracoastal, have a birthday dinner, and do some sightseeing over the course of five days. On the morning of February 3rd you even emailed the itinerary to all of us. Later that morning you had the spontaneous bleed in your brain. Even though we spent your birthday together, it was in a hospital room and you were in a coma. One week later, you passed away...
